Bull Run Lake
AI-suggested draft · review before you go
No permit or access details on file for this trail — check with the local land manager before you go.
Bull Run Lake is a scenic alpine lake hike offering rewarding views with moderate effort. The trail climbs steadily through forested terrain, gaining over 1,200 feet to reach the pristine lake nestled in a mountain basin. This out-and-back route combines accessible distance with meaningful elevation gain, making it ideal for hikers seeking alpine scenery without extreme technical demands.
